At a Glance
- Tasks: Design and build fantastic APIs to simplify travel experiences.
- Company: Join a forward-thinking travel tech company transforming the industry.
- Benefits: Own a share of the company, enjoy personal growth, and work in a supportive environment.
- Why this job: Make a real impact on the future of travel with cutting-edge technology.
- Qualifications: Passion for API design and a collaborative mindset; experience in Elixir is a plus.
- Other info: Dynamic team culture with opportunities for career advancement.
The predicted salary is between 36000 - 60000 £ per year.
Create the future of travel with us. Whether it’s a personal trip or a business trip, travel is essential. More than 4 billion airline passengers rely on technology that hasn't kept up with the expectations of the modern connected traveller. We are rebuilding the infrastructure that underpins the travel industry, simplifying systems and building the tools that will make the future of travel effortless. Backed by Benchmark, Blossom, Index Ventures and Kima Ventures, our London team is growing and we’re looking for talented people to join us.
We’re building tools to simplify travel distribution, search and booking. What does that mean? A seamless API before integrating with hundreds of airlines, navigating the differing needs and systems of each airline while delivering a fantastic developer experience. The tools on the team include Elixir, Phoenix, Kubernetes and Google Cloud Platform.
What We’re Looking For In You
- A passion for designing and building fantastic APIs, delivering great developer experiences.
- An interest in working with Elixir; previous experience is not required.
- Focus on engineering ability.
- A high bar in code quality and API design.
- Opinions on good engineering standards and processes.
- Big‑picture thinking: make trade‑offs on technical work streams against business impact.
- Fantastic communication skills: articulate what you’re working on and why in a clear and structured way.
- Collaborative mindset: open to suggestions and feedback, while bringing your own methods.
- Bonus if you have experience in travel, flights, hotels or cars.
What You Can Expect From Us
We are dedicated to your personal growth. Our environment is comfortable physically and in that we always listen to ideas, concerns and questions. We believe everyone should take pride in their work, take full ownership and its impact. Everyone who joins Duffel owns a share of the company.
Equal Opportunities Statement
We are an equal‑opportunities employer. Recruitment decisions are based on experience and skills. We welcome applicants of all ages, sexes, disabilities, sexual orientations, races, religions or beliefs.
Note to Recruitment Agencies
Duffel does not accept speculative CVs from external parties. Unsolicited CVs will be treated as property of Duffel.
AI in Recruitment
We may use AI tools to support parts of the hiring process, but final hiring decisions are made by humans.
Software Engineer (Backend) employer: Duffel
Contact Detail:
Duffel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Engineer (Backend)
✨Tip Number 1
Network like a pro! Reach out to people in the industry, attend meetups, and connect with current employees at Duffel. A friendly chat can sometimes lead to opportunities that aren’t even advertised.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your best API designs or any projects you've worked on. This is your chance to demonstrate your passion for building fantastic tools and your engineering ability.
✨Tip Number 3
Prepare for the interview by brushing up on Elixir and the tools mentioned in the job description. Even if you don’t have experience, showing enthusiasm and a willingness to learn can really impress the team.
✨Tip Number 4
Apply through our website! It’s the best way to ensure your application gets seen. Plus, it shows you’re genuinely interested in joining the Duffel team and contributing to the future of travel.
We think you need these skills to ace Software Engineer (Backend)
Some tips for your application 🫡
Show Your Passion: Let us see your enthusiasm for building fantastic APIs and delivering great developer experiences. Share any personal projects or experiences that highlight your passion for software engineering, especially if they relate to travel!
Tailor Your CV: Make sure your CV reflects the skills and experiences that align with what we're looking for. Highlight your engineering abilities, code quality, and any relevant experience with Elixir or similar technologies.
Craft a Compelling Cover Letter: Use your cover letter to tell us why you want to join our team at Duffel. Be clear about how your background and interests fit with our mission to simplify travel distribution and enhance the developer experience.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ures it gets into the right hands quickly. Plus, it shows you're keen on joining our team!
How to prepare for a job interview at Duffel
✨Know Your APIs
Make sure you brush up on your API design principles before the interview. Be ready to discuss your thoughts on what makes a great API and how you would approach building one. This will show your passion for delivering fantastic developer experiences, which is key for the role.
✨Familiarise Yourself with Elixir
Even if you haven't worked with Elixir before, take some time to learn the basics. Understanding its syntax and features will help you engage in meaningful conversations during the interview. Plus, it shows your willingness to learn and adapt, which is something they value.
✨Communicate Clearly
Practice articulating your past projects and experiences in a clear and structured way. Being able to explain your thought process and decisions will demonstrate your fantastic communication skills, which are essential for collaboration within the team.
✨Think Big Picture
Prepare to discuss how you would balance technical work with business impact. They’re looking for someone who can make trade-offs effectively, so think about examples from your experience where you had to consider both sides. This will highlight your big-picture thinking and engineering ability.